Building Your Colorado Springs Dream Team: Essential Professionals for Investors

Muldoon Associates

They oversee the day-to-day operations of rental properties, ensuring that everything runs smoothly. This includes tasks like tenant screening, lease enforcement, and property maintenance. Effective property managers can help you achieve lower vacancy rates by keeping tenants satisfied and addressing issues promptly.

Problems with Self-Managing Investment Properties

Florida Property Management

Real estate investment requires a deep understanding of property laws, local regulations, tenant-landlord relationships, and property maintenance. Attending landlord-tenant workshops, reading books, and networking with experienced investors can help bridge the knowledge gap.
